Bronze ge, Spring and Autumn period, Eastern Zhou dynasty, China, 5th century BC. 
Bronze ge, Spring and Autumn period, Eastern Zhou dynasty, China, 5th century BC. A bronze ge with good patination. The horizontal flange is incised with stylised phoenixes on both sides. The halberd has rectangular holes adjacent to the vertical flange.
